1. The Dynamic Studio: Why Fixed Ventilation Fails the Artist

In a traditional factory setting, machines are bolted to the floor, allowing for permanent ductwork. However, a large-scale art studio is a living, breathing ecosystem.

The Challenge of Scale and Movement

A ten-meter-tall bronze sculpture cannot be moved to a small “sanding station.” Instead, the artist must move around the sculpture.

  • The Geographic Gap: If the dust extraction point is fixed to a wall, the artist quickly loses protection as they move to the opposite side of the piece.

  • Multi-Process Conflict: An artist may spend the morning TIG welding and the afternoon angle-grinding. These processes produce different types of pollutants—one a toxic gas, the other a heavy combustible dust. A static system rarely handles this versatility efficiently.

The Mobile Solution

Mobile dust collection systems are designed for this exact fluidity. Equipped with heavy-duty casters and flexible extraction arms, they allow the “protection zone” to travel with the artist. Whether working on a scaffold or tucked inside a hollow metal casting, the artist can position the suction hood exactly where the sparks fly.

2. Versatility in Craft: One System, Multiple Masterpieces

The beauty of a high-quality mobile collector lies in its “chameleonic” ability to adapt to different artistic media.

Metalwork: Taming the Fumes and Sparks

Welding and plasma cutting are staples of modern sculpture. These processes release sub-micron metal oxides that are easily inhaled.

  • The “Second Hand” Role: The flexible arm of a portable extractor acts like an assistant holding a vacuum. It captures hot fumes at the source before they can rise into the artist’s breathing zone, while spark-arresting pre-filters ensure the system remains safe during high-heat operations.

Wood and Stone: Managing Massive Volume

When carving large-scale timber or marble, the volume of dust is immense.

  • High-Capacity Filtration: Professional mobile dust collection systems utilize HEPA or PTFE-coated cartridge filters that can handle heavy loading. They prevent the “white fog” of stone dust from settling on every surface of the studio, protecting sensitive electronics and finished works located elsewhere in the shop.

Composite Materials and Resins

For theater sets and modern pop-art installations, fiberglass and resin are common. Sanding these materials creates a fine, “itchy” dust that is both a health hazard and a fire risk. The mobile unit’s high static pressure effectively captures even the smallest particles. It pulls the most stubborn particles directly into the filtration chamber.

3. The Anatomy of an Invisible Assistant: Technical Features

To truly support an artist, a mobile dust collector must be more than just a vacuum; it must be a piece of precision engineering.

  1. 360-Degree Flexible Suction Arms: These arms must be “self-supporting,” meaning they stay in the exact position the artist places them. This allows the artist to focus both hands on their tool while the “second hand” manages the air.

  2. Multi-Stage Filtration: From a primary metal mesh (for sparks) to a secondary bag filter (for large debris) and a final HEPA filter (for 99.97% of fine particles), the system ensures that the air exhausted back into the studio is cleaner than the ambient air.

  3. Low Noise Signature: Art requires focus. A loud, industrial drone can be fatiguing. Modern mobile units are sound-dampened to operate at decibel levels that allow for conversation or music to be heard in the background.

4. Safety as a Creative Catalyst: The Psychological Impact

When a workshop is clean, the creative process accelerates. Dust is not just a physical nuisance; it is a mental burden.

  • Eliminating Post-Work Cleanup: Large-scale projects can take months. If dust is allowed to settle, the final cleanup can take weeks. By capturing dust at the source, mobile dust collection systems keep the studio in a state of “permanent readiness.”

  • Artist Longevity: Respiratory issues are the leading professional hazard for long-term sculptors. Providing a clean environment ensures that the artist can continue their craft for decades, preserving their health as carefully as they preserve their art.

  • Compliance Without Complexity: For public art institutions and universities, safety regulations are strict. Mobile collectors offer an “out-of-the-box” solution that meets OSHA or local health standards without the need for expensive structural renovations.

5. From Theaters to Plazas: Diverse Application Scenarios

The portability of these systems allows them to move beyond the traditional studio:

  • Theatre Scenery Shops: Where massive wooden structures are built and painted in rapid succession.

  • On-Site Restoration: When a public monument needs cleaning or repair in a city plaza, a mobile collector can be brought to the site to prevent dust from affecting the public.

  • Prototyping Labs: Where 3D printing and manual finishing happen side-by-side.
